Product Description: 1,1-Bis(4-aminophenyl)cyclohexane is primarily utilized in the production of high-performance polymers, particularly polyimides and epoxy resins. Its structure, featuring two amine groups, makes it a valuable monomer for synthesizing materials with excellent thermal stability, mechanical strength, and chemical resistance. These polymers are widely used in aerospace, electronics, and automotive industries for applications such as insulating films, coatings, and adhesives. Additionally, it serves as an intermediate in the synthesis of dyes and pigments, contributing to the development of colorants for textiles and plastics. Its role in creating advanced materials underscores its importance in industrial and technological applications.
